首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ubuntu 打开mysql文件

基础概念

MySQL是一种关系型数据库管理系统,广泛用于Web应用程序的开发和其他需要存储和检索数据的场景。Ubuntu是一个流行的Linux发行版,它提供了多种方式来安装和管理MySQL服务器。

打开MySQL文件

在Ubuntu上打开MySQL文件通常指的是访问MySQL的配置文件、日志文件或者数据库文件。以下是一些常见的文件及其用途:

  1. 配置文件 (my.cnfmy.ini): 存储MySQL服务器的配置设置。
  2. 错误日志文件 (通常是 hostname.err): 记录MySQL服务器运行时的错误和警告信息。
  3. 二进制日志文件 (通常是 hostname-bin.*): 记录所有的DDL和DML(除了数据查询语句)语句,以事件形式记录,还包含语句所执行的消耗的时间。
  4. 数据库文件 (位于MySQL的数据目录中,通常是 var/lib/mysql/): 存储实际的数据库数据。

如何打开MySQL文件

访问配置文件

MySQL的配置文件通常位于 /etc/mysql/ 目录下。你可以使用文本编辑器打开它:

代码语言:txt
复制
sudo nano /etc/mysql/my.cnf

或者使用 vim:

代码语言:txt
复制
sudo vim /etc/mysql/my.cnf

查看错误日志

错误日志文件的位置可以在MySQL配置文件中找到,通常在 [mysqld] 部分的 log-error 设置。假设错误日志文件位于 /var/log/mysql/error.log,你可以使用以下命令查看:

代码语言:txt
复制
sudo tail -f /var/log/mysql/error.log

访问数据库文件

数据库文件通常位于MySQL的数据目录中。你可以使用文件浏览器或者命令行工具来访问这个目录:

代码语言:txt
复制
sudo ls /var/lib/mysql/

请注意,直接操作数据库文件需要非常小心,因为不当的操作可能会导致数据损坏。

应用场景

  • 配置管理: 开发者和系统管理员需要修改MySQL的配置文件来调整服务器的行为。
  • 故障排查: 查看错误日志文件可以帮助诊断MySQL服务器的问题。
  • 数据恢复: 在某些情况下,可能需要直接访问数据库文件来进行数据恢复。

可能遇到的问题及解决方法

如果你在尝试打开MySQL文件时遇到权限问题,可以尝试使用 sudo 命令来获取必要的权限。如果文件不存在或者路径不正确,检查MySQL的配置文件来确定正确的路径。

如果你需要进一步的帮助,可以提供具体的错误信息或者你想要执行的操作,以便得到更详细的指导。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券